What Is Co-location?
Co-location (often written as colocation or colo) is a specialized service where organizations rent physical space in a data center to house their server hardware. Unlike cloud or shared hosting, where the provider owns the servers, businesses using co-location supply their own equipment while taking advantage of robust professional facilities.
With co-location, you retain total ownership and control of your hardware but benefit from advanced security, redundant power, and climate-controlled environments offered by data center operators. At a quick glance, it’s an ideal middle-ground between running servers in your office and using fully managed cloud solutions.
How Co-location Works
When you use co-location services, you install your servers, storage devices, and networking gear in a rented rack (or portion of a rack) within a data center. The provider ensures reliable power, constant cooling, and strict physical security. You manage your systems remotely or on-site, depending on your agreement.
This setup lets you keep total hardware control while offloading essential facility management and access to enterprise-grade infrastructure. Many providers also offer “remote hands” support, helping address hardware issues without needing to send your team for every incident.
Key Benefits of Co-location
Why do modern businesses turn to co-location? The main difference that stands out compared to hosting at your own site is the professional environment and reliability. Below are the standout advantages:
- Enhanced Security: Data centers invest in multi-layered controls, including biometric access, surveillance, and manned security.
- Maximum Uptime: Redundant power supplies, backup generators, and robust cooling prevent service interruptions.
- Cost-Effective Scaling: Expanding storage or processing is as simple as leasing more rack space—no need for expensive facility upgrades.
- Better Bandwidth: Data centers provide direct connections to top-tier internet carriers, reducing latency and boosting speeds.
- Compliance Ready: Many facilities are certified for standards like ISO, SOC, or HIPAA, making regulatory compliance easier.
Cost Factors and Considerations
While co-location can seem pricey upfront, it often results in significant long-term savings. The costs typically break down into:
- Space rental: Measured in rack units (U), quarter-racks, half-racks, or full racks depending on your needs.
- Power usage: Charged based on the amount of electricity your hardware consumes.
- Bandwidth fees: Based on the level of internet connectivity required.
- Setup and remote hands: One-time fees for installation and ongoing support as needed.
A quick glance at modern data center pricing shows that, compared to building or maintaining an on-premise facility, co-location offers better economies of scale. However, you’ll need to balance initial migration costs against these long-term benefits, especially as your infrastructure grows.
Co-location vs Other Hosting Options
Co-location vs On-premises Hosting
Running servers in your own office gives you direct access, but you assume full responsibility for uptime, energy, cooling, and security. Co-location lets you offload these challenges to professionals who specialize in redundancy and reliability.
Co-location vs Dedicated Hosting
In dedicated hosting, you rent both the server and the data center space, giving up full hardware control in exchange for lower upfront costs. With co-location, you keep your own equipment, enabling custom configurations and easier hardware upgrades.
Co-location vs Cloud Hosting
Cloud hosting means using someone else’s virtual infrastructure, often sacrificing hardware control for maximum flexibility and scalability. Co-location is ideal when you need predictable performance, specialized hardware, or have regulatory requirements that cloud cannot fully match.
| Option | Hardware Control | Scalability | Upfront Cost | Customization |
|---|---|---|---|---|
| Co-location | Full | Easy (space dependent) | High | Maximum |
| On-premises | Full | Limited | Very High | Maximum |
| Dedicated Hosting | Medium | Easy | Medium | Some |
| Cloud Hosting | Low | Unlimited | Low | Limited |
Choosing a Co-location Provider
The data center landscape features many providers, each offering unique combinations of services, locations, and support levels. When comparing, a few factors immediately stand out:
- Location: Proximity to your business and clients for optimum performance and easy hardware access.
- Uptime guarantees: Look for Service Level Agreements (SLAs) with 99.9% (or higher) uptime.
- Security: Physical and digital safeguards, plus compliance with industry standards.
- Support services: On-site staff, remote hands, and technical support response times.
- Expansion ability: Capacity to grow with your business, whether it’s a single rack or a private cage.
Some providers also specialize by industry or offer managed hybrid solutions, blending co-location with cloud hosting. Ask about connectivity options and if tours or audits are permitted—seeing the facility firsthand often reveals important details.
